Golden Crab Cakes (Print Version)

# Ingredients:

→ Crab Cakes

01 - 1 tbsp chopped fresh parsley
02 - 1 tsp garlic powder
03 - 1 large egg, beaten
04 - 1 tbsp lemon juice
05 - 1 tsp Old Bay seasoning
06 - Salt and pepper, adjust to your liking
07 - 1 lb lump crab meat, sorted through for shells
08 - 2 tbsp olive oil for cooking
09 - 1/2 cup panko crumbs
10 - 1/4 cup mayo
11 - 1 tbsp Dijon mustard

→ Dipping Sauce

12 - Fresh parsley for topping
13 - 1 tsp hot sauce, optional
14 - 1/4 cup mayo
15 - 1 tbsp Dijon mustard
16 - 1 tbsp lemon juice

# Instructions:

01 - Warm oven to 375°F. Cover a baking sheet with parchment and lightly oil it.
02 - Stir together crab chunks, egg, mayo, panko, mustard, spices, parsley, and lemon juice. Be gentle so the crab stays whole.
03 - Roll the mixture into patties (makes about 8-10) and arrange them on the baking sheet.
04 - Bake until golden, about 15-20 minutes. For a crispier finish, broil for 1-2 minutes at the end.
05 - Combine mayo, mustard, lemon juice, and optional hot sauce. Sprinkle parsley on top before serving.
